2006 Woman of
Distinction
Honoree
Dr. Uma Chowdry
VP-CR&D
Dupont

Born and raised in India, Dr. Uma Chowdhry came to
the US in 1968 with a B.S. in Physics from Indian Institute of
Science, Mumbai University, received an M.S. from Caltech in
Engineering Science in 1970 and a PhD in Materials Science from MIT
in 1976. Uma Chowdhry joined DuPont in 1977 as a research scientist,
has held various technology & business management positions in
corporate R&D, electronics and chemicals businesses. She was
promoted to VP-CR&D in 2002.
For contributions to the science of ceramics, Uma was
elected "Fellow" of the American Ceramic Society in 1989, elected to
the National Academy of Engineering in 1996, and elected to the
American Academy of Arts and Sciences in 2003.
Uma serves on various boards and committees including
the Industrial Research Institute, National Inventors Hall of Fame,
Department of Energy’s Laboratory Operations, National Committee for
Women in Science and Engineering, and the advisory board of
University of Delaware’s Engineering school.
